I really like the name you've chosen, though I'm not sure how it describes the board... Upon further consideration you may not want to use that name as it might give people the impression that the keys are mushy :p

One thing to keep in mind about key cap compatibility - it might be more of a nightmare than you might be thinking as there isn't currently a 6u mold for an SA profile space bar. So you're probably limiting the board to using DSA sets only. There is a SA set going on zfrontier that says is has a 6u space bar, but it could be a mistake. I think I read that Danger Zone offered a 6u space bar, but had to cancel it when SP said the mold didn't exist once the order was submitted (don't quote me on that though).

I'm interested in the stagger you've chosen. It looks kind of odd that the top and bottom rows are non-staggered, but the middle rows are staggered by 0.25u. I'd recommend either maintaining the stagger across each row for consistency (which would probably throw off your 15u target), or go fully ortholinear.
